Qt
Internal/Contributor docs for the Qt SDK. Note: These are NOT official API docs; those are found at https://doc.qt.io/
Loading...
Searching...
No Matches
JBig2_SymbolDict.cpp
Go to the documentation of this file.
1
// Copyright 2014 The PDFium Authors
2
// Use of this source code is governed by a BSD-style license that can be
3
// found in the LICENSE file.
4
5
// Original code copyright 2014 Foxit Software Inc. http://www.foxitsoftware.com
6
7
#
include
"core/fxcodec/jbig2/JBig2_SymbolDict.h"
8
9
#
include
"core/fxcodec/jbig2/JBig2_Image.h"
10
11
CJBig2_SymbolDict
::
CJBig2_SymbolDict
() =
default
;
12
13
CJBig2_SymbolDict
::~
CJBig2_SymbolDict
() =
default
;
14
15
std
::
unique_ptr
<
CJBig2_SymbolDict
>
CJBig2_SymbolDict
::
DeepCopy
()
const
{
16
auto
dst =
std
::make_unique<
CJBig2_SymbolDict
>();
17
for
(
const
auto
& image : m_SDEXSYMS) {
18
dst->m_SDEXSYMS.push_back(image ? std::make_unique<CJBig2_Image>(*image)
19
:
nullptr
);
20
}
21
dst->m_gbContext = m_gbContext;
22
dst->m_grContext = m_grContext;
23
return
dst;
24
}
CJBig2_SymbolDict
Definition
JBig2_SymbolDict.h:18
CJBig2_SymbolDict::~CJBig2_SymbolDict
~CJBig2_SymbolDict()
CJBig2_SymbolDict::DeepCopy
std::unique_ptr< CJBig2_SymbolDict > DeepCopy() const
Definition
JBig2_SymbolDict.cpp:15
CJBig2_SymbolDict::CJBig2_SymbolDict
CJBig2_SymbolDict()
std
Definition
qfloat16.h:492
qtwebengine
src
3rdparty
chromium
third_party
pdfium
core
fxcodec
jbig2
JBig2_SymbolDict.cpp
Generated on Sat Sep 21 2024 00:54:47 for Qt by
1.12.0